(CITY OF GUELPH) At 8:20pm on Friday May 26th 2023, three hit & runs involving the same vehicle occurred in the downtown area of Guelph. At 8:30pm a white Chevrolet pickup truck was seen striking two parked cars along Wellington Street West and then driving away. Minutes later the same […]